The hexadecimal color code #91AAFA corresponds to the code RGB( 145, 170, 250 ). It's a shade of Blue. This color is a combination of red (at 0,57 level), green (at 0,67 level) and blue (at 0,98 level). Its brightness is 77% and its saturation is 91%. It is composed of red at 25%, green at 30% and blue at 44%.
